Domestic violence
Police arrested a 31-year-old man at a Valla address on Saturday afternoon following a domestic violence incident in which a 25-year-old woman allegedly sustained a facial injury and property was damaged.
The man was charged at Macksville Police Station and released on bail to appear before Macksville Local Court tomorrow (Thursday).
Mid range drink drive
A 28-year-old man was arrested by police on Tuesday night after a single vehicle accident on Talarm Rd, Talarm.
The driver was uninjured after the vehicle left the roadway and rolled onto its side, however he returned a positive RBT result.
He underwent a breath analysis at Macksville Police Station where he returned a mid range PCA of 0.105.
The man was issued a court attendance notice to appear before Macksville Local Court on March 14 as well as an infringement notice for Negligent Driving.
